#9b3b1c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9b3b1c is composed of 60.8% red, 23.1%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.9% magenta, 81.9%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 14.6 degrees, a saturation of 69.4% and a lightness of 35.9%. #9b3b1c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7638 with #370000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#9b3b1c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9b3b1c has RGB values of R:155, G:59,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.82,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10173212.

Hex triplet 9b3b1c #9b3b1c
RGB Decimal 155, 59, 28 rgb(155,59,28)
RGB Percent 60.8, 23.1, 11 rgb(60.8%,23.1%,11%)
CMYK 0, 62, 82, 39
HSL 14.6°, 69.4, 35.9 hsl(14.6,69.4%,35.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 14.6°, 81.9, 60.8
Web Safe 993333 #993333
CIE-LAB 38.167, 38.464, 38.438
XYZ 15.292, 10.182, 2.259
xyY 0.551, 0.367, 10.182
CIE-LCH 38.167, 54.378, 44.981
CIE-LUV 38.167, 75.464, 27.744
Hunter-Lab 31.909, 29.701, 18.14
Binary 10011011, 00111011, 00011100

Shades and Tints of #9b3b1c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050201 is the darkest color, while #fdf6f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9b3b1c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5b5b is the less saturated color, while #b03007 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#9b3b1c is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#545454 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#624f49 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#6c622f Protanopia 1% of men
  • #7a5d1f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#a14145 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#7d5428 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#86511e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#9f3f36 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
